Quarterly Planning Note — Cash-Flow Forecast, Q3

For the Orvandel Crafts finance team. Inflows are projected up 6%, led by the Senna range; outflows rise modestly on warehousing. The buffer holds above policy minimum through week eleven. Assumptions and sensitivities are attached. The confidential note on business plans is set out directly below.

board note of bajop-yaweg: The western region missed its Pelys quota by 58.0 percent last quarter. Pelysek Foods plans to raise the Belius list price by 44.0 percent in July. The steering committee signed off on a budget of $133.8 million for Project Pelax. The renewal with Zoraelix Systems closes at $61.9 million a year, 12.7 percent above the last contract.

UserSplit Cutover Drift: the extracted account service and the legacy Marigold monolith user module are reporting divergent record counts during dual-write. This fires when drift exceeds 0.5% over 15 minutes. New team members should not replay writes manually. Reconciliation steps and the rollback procedure are documented on the internal page.

wiki page, tajog-fafog: https://gitlab.paliqsys.corp/dash/display/job/853dd6fcbf54

## Formula sandbox tuning

User-supplied formulas in Gridmoor execute inside a restricted interpreter with hard ceilings on time, memory, and call depth. Reviewers should confirm any change to these ceilings is justified in the PR description, since raising them widens the abuse surface. Defaults were chosen from production traces. The current limits are as follows.

limits module of tafog-fawip:
WEIGHTS = {
    "julix": 57,
    "lamys": 992,
    "kasvan": 209,
    "quenok": 750,
    "alddor": 259,
    "oliath": 1009,
    "wenix": 815,
}

Backfill scheduler basics (Project Nightloom): nightly jobs queue at 01:00, oldest partition first. Never rerun a backfill without clearing its ledger row, or you get duplicates. Dashboards show lag per dataset. Escalate if lag exceeds two days. To unlock the scheduler's admin vault on first login, use the passphrase below.

unlock words, hahap-kafog: praox-druwyn